ROME – Hans-Dieter Flick would be the top choice of the Friedkin family to replace Josรฉ Mourinho on Roma’s bench in the event of a defeat against Cagliari says a report from ‘Corriere Dello Sport‘. It would be a mid-season change, something Roma has not experienced since the departure of Di Francesco in 2019 and the arrival of Claudio Ranieri as a caretaker until the end of the season.

This situation is causing turmoil among Roma fans and makes the match against Cagliari (coached by Ranieri, ironically) even more significant and crucial.

Hans-Dieter Flick is the top name on the Friedkin family’s list, and he is the only coach to have been dismissed from the helm of the German national team in its 123-year history. The defeat last September in a friendly match against Japan (4-1), proved to be the final straw.

In 25 matches with the National team, he only managed to secure 12 victories, while Die Mannschaft was eliminated in the group stage of the World Cup for the second consecutive time. Currently, Germany has not won a match since March 25th of last year and has lost its last three games against Poland, Colombia, and Japan.

Flick is now monitoring the situation at Roma, waiting for the opportunity to take a new coaching position after his successful stint with Bayern Munich, where he won everything that there was to be won.

He led Bayern to victory in the Bundesliga, the German Cup, and the Champions League, achieving the classical treble. At the start of the 2020-2021 season, the coach also won the European Super Cup and the German Super Cup, and in February, he secured the Club World Cup, completing the sextuple โ€“ a feat previously accomplished only by Guardiola with Barcelona in 2009.

He closed the season with another Bundesliga title and was awarded the UEFA Coach of the Year for the previous season. After Bayern he accepted the role of the German national team’s head coach, but without finding success.

The disappointment in the World Cup and his subsequent dismissal now fuel his desire to embark on a new adventure, with his phone always on. However, his arrival would not be easy, as the Roma fan base is fully behind Mourinho and strongly opposed to the departure of the Portuguese coach.
